Class PromotionsContext

  • All Implemented Interfaces:
    javaposse.jobdsl.dsl.Context

    public class PromotionsContext
    extends Object
    implements javaposse.jobdsl.dsl.Context
    • Constructor Detail

      • PromotionsContext

        public PromotionsContext​(javaposse.jobdsl.plugin.DslEnvironment dslEnvironment)
    • Method Detail

      • promotion

        public void promotion​(groovy.lang.Closure<?> promotionClosure)
        See the examples below. PromotionNodes:
         1. <string>dev</string>
         2. <string>test</string>
         
         AND
         
         Sub PromotionNode for every promotion:
         1. <project>
         <name>dev</name>
         .
         .
         .
         </project>
         2. <project>
         <name>test</name>
         .
         .
         .
         </project>
         
        Parameters:
        promotionClosure - Input closure